Thats not necessarily true. Gannon, Brad Johnson, Doug Williams, etc were all over 30 when they really bloomed and found a system and team willing to give them a chance.. Now I not saying Gus will suddenly be a pro bowler (even though he was 1x before) but I am saying that he showed an efficiency unlike any other time in his career during his 3 game stint in minny. While it was only 3 games we have comprarable weapons and a stronger D that will allow him to not try and do the spectacular just excute what is expected of him. He also has the confidence of our OC which doesnt hurt. Remember Gus is 32-33 years old, that also means hes going to play smarter than he has in the past by virtue of understanding more of the pro game than he did when he was previously a starter in wash and he played pretty good for a young qb (back then).
